Should You Buy a 1992 Moto Guzzi 850 T3?

The 1992 Moto Guzzi 850 T3 is a classic touring motorcycle that embodies the spirit of long-distance riding with its robust V-Twin engine. With a horsepower of 62 hp and torque of 49 lb-ft, it offers a balanced performance for both highway cruising and city commuting. The 5-speed manual transmission and shaft drive system provide a smooth and reliable ride, making it an appealing choice for enthusiasts looking for a vintage touring experience. While specific MPG figures are unknown, the use of regular unleaded fuel adds to its practicality for everyday use.

This motorcycle is designed for riders who appreciate the charm of classic Italian engineering and the comfort of a touring bike. The Moto Guzzi 850 T3 is not just about performance; it also offers a unique aesthetic that stands out in a sea of modern motorcycles, making it a great choice for collectors and riders who value character and history in their machines.

Performance

Horsepower
62 hp
Torque
49 lb-ft
Engine
0.9 L
Cylinders
V-Twin
Transmission
5-speed manual
Drive Type
shaft drive
